Subject: Telemetry gateway cut-over — done!

Welcome aboard, folks. Quick recap: we moved the Furrowlink farm-equipment telemetry gateway off the legacy collector last night. Tractors and combines in the Dellworth pilot region reported cleanly within minutes, and message lag stayed under two seconds. Old endpoint stays up read-only for a week. For reference, the gateway now runs with this configuration.

settings of tagef-bawif:
DRUIX_HOST=druix.zemvarlabs.internal
DRUIX_PORT=8000

When upgrading the Quillbus broker from 4.x to 5.x, drain all consumer groups first, then stop the coordinator node. Run the schema migration tool before restarting, not after — reversing the order corrupts offset records. If consumers report stale partition maps afterward, restart them in any order; the coordinator reconciles within a minute. To pull the 5.x packages from the Marrowgate internal registry, the fetch script expects this credential.

session JWT of yawep-yawep = eyJhbGciOiJIUzI1NiIsInR5cCI6IkpXVCJ9.eyJzdWIiOiI3pWF3_In0.aXYsHiog

Deploy step 4 — Paritywatch rate-parity checker. After the scraper fleet is drained, ship the new comparison engine to the ledger host and run the schema migration. The checker will refuse to start if the booking-feed credential is absent, and on-call has been paged twice this month for exactly that, so confirm it before restarting. Open the service env file at /opt/paritywatch/.env, confirm the feed host is set to quillport-prod, and append the secret as this line.

vault entry, yahif-yajep: COURIER_KEY29=b802bdf8034096b65a51c6ba5abe2

The Splitgate assignment service is returning 5xx above 2% over five minutes. Effect: new sessions fall back to control; running experiments accumulate skew. Do not proceed with release cuts while this fires — assignment hashes may drift across versions. Check recent config pushes to the Splitgate flag store first; most incidents trace there. Rollback of the flag store is safe; rollback of the service itself is not without sign-off. If unresolved in thirty minutes, notify the owning team at the address below.

escalation mailbox, yafog-kafof: eliok@xolmarcloud.local